Feb 26th Saturday
Weather Overcast - 73F
Check-out day
We had bought souvenir mugs for the free refills at the food court beverage station, so we decided to use them one more time before we left. We all liked the raspberry iced tea
We left All Stars Movies Fantasia at 11am and headed to DTD.
Browsed through the World of Disney, strolled the shopping area then set off for some outlet stores
Didnt find any deals so we continued on to our next accommodation (my timeshare at Oak Plantation, Kissimmee) picked up some groceries on the way at the Super Wal-Mart on Hwy 192 (that place is always busy
) and finally got to check-in at around 2pm.
Even though we were no longer staying on Disney property, we still had lots of Quick & Casual vouchers to use up, so we decided to go again to Coronado Springs resort to the Pepper Market. My DD noticed that the gate guard at the resort was the same as the previous time, and wondered if he recognized her. He was VERY nice.
We had been to Pepper Market on a previous trip in 2004 and at that time had a waitress who hovered around and couldnt wait for the plates to become empty before scooping them up. We named her The Vulture.
Normally, we like to have attentive service for things such as refilling drinks etc, but this waitress watched our every move and we felt very uncomfortable.
At this visit to Pepper Market we couldnt believe it, she was still working there!!!
OMG, She watched us again. We know that Q&C vouchers have the tip included, but this waitress wants extra, once again we felt uncomfortable. After supper, we browsed the gift shop (always looking for that little something thats different from the other places) then headed back to the timeshare.
Oh well, even though we didnt do Parks we still had some Disney in our day.
